Product Information

Extended Description

FLB221 TT15 2 Eaton: Eaton Crouse-Hinds series FLB circuit breaker, 15A, TEB frame type, Thermal magnetic, Threaded cover construction, Copper-free aluminum, General Electric breaker, Two-pole, Non-interchangeable trip, 1", 240 Vac/125-250 Vdc
